Letter to the editor: Transforming lives using adventure in Summit County
Breckenridge
As the snow melts and we transition into another busy summer, the Breckenridge Outdoor Education Center is reflecting with gratitude on an incredible winter season of adaptive skiing and snowboarding in Summit County where adventure knows no limits. Thanks to our dedicated staff, volunteers, and vital partners like Breckenridge, Keystone and Vail Resorts EpicPromise, we made skiing and snowboarding accessible to hundreds of individuals with disabilities and special needs.
But the adventure doesn’t stop with the snowmelt. Breckenridge Outdoor Education Center is already gearing up for a summer packed with adaptive rafting, rock climbing, cycling, wilderness expeditions and more. Every activity continues our mission: expanding the potential of people of all abilities through meaningful outdoor experiences.
Next year, Breckenridge Outdoor Education Center will celebrate 50 years of transforming lives through outdoor adventure. A milestone we can’t wait to share with the community that has supported us every step of the way. As we look ahead, we are committed to expanding access, breaking barriers, and welcoming even more individuals to life-changing outdoor experiences.
